How are King Edward Park's scores calculated?
Each lens is a 0 to 100 weighted composite of percentile-ranked sub-components, computed from population-weighted dissemination-area data. Because it is a weighted blend rather than a rank, a score of 60 does not mean "better than 60% of neighbourhoods": the percentile figures on this page state that standing separately. Higher is better, except climate which reflects mapped hazard exposure.
